Q: What is the official title of the online seminar for which archive videos and detailed reports have been made available?
A: The official title of the online seminar for which the archive videos and reports have been released is designated as 'Next GIGA Talk! 2026'.
Q: Which organization is responsible for releasing the archive videos and comprehensive reports from the 'Next GIGA Talk! 2026' online seminar?
A: LoiLo Inc. has officially released the archive videos and detailed reports pertaining to each session of the 'Next GIGA Talk! 2026' online seminar.
Q: How many individual sessions comprised the 'Next GIGA Talk! 2026' online seminar, and during which months did these sessions take place?
A: The 'Next GIGA Talk! 2026' online seminar was composed of five individual sessions in total, which were conducted sequentially from January to February 2026.
Q: Could you describe the main focus and key topic addressed during the first session of the 'Next GIGA Talk! 2026' online seminar?
A: The first session of 'Next GIGA Talk! 2026' primarily focused on 'Digital Citizenship Education Promoted by Education Boards × Schools' and explored methods to redesign children's relationship with digital technology.
Q: Who were the designated speakers that presented during the first session, which addressed Digital Citizenship Education, at the 'Next GIGA Talk! 2026' event?
A: The designated speakers for the first session on Digital Citizenship Education were Kazuma Hayashi from Gifu Shotoku Gakuen University and Makiya Tsuchida, Chief of the GIGA School Promotion Office, Gifu City Board of Education.
